‖Fruc′ti‐fi‐ca″tion (?), n. [[L. fructificatio: cf. F. fructification.]] 1. 1. The act of forming or producing fruit; the act of fructifying, or rendering productive of fruit; fecundation.
The prevalent fructification of plants. Sir T. Brown. 2. 2. (Bot.) (a) The collective organs by which a plant produces its fruit, or seeds, or reproductive spores. (b) The process of producing fruit, or seeds, or spores.
